アクセシブルなフォームデザインについての質問

ITの初心者
アクセシブルなフォームデザインを考える場合、具体的にどのようなポイントに注意を払うべきでしょうか?

IT・PC専門家
まずは、フォームに使用されるラベルを明確にし、視覚障害者が利用するスクリーンリーダーとの互換性を持たせることが非常に重要です。また、色覚に配慮した適切なカラーコントラストを設定することや、キーボードのみで操作できるナビゲーションをデザインすることも忘れてはいけません。さらに、分かりやすいエラーメッセージを表示させることによって、ユーザーに対して具体的なフィードバックを提供することも役立ちます。

ITの初心者
色のコントラストが重要なのはなぜですか?具体的な例を挙げて教えてください。

IT・PC専門家
色のコントラストが非常に重要である理由は、視覚に障害がある方々にとって、情報を正確に読み取るためには明確なコントラストが必須だからです。例えば、白い背景に薄いグレーの文字を使用すると、色覚特性の異なるユーザーにはほとんど見えなくなることがあります。一方で、黒い文字と白い背景の組み合わせは、多くのユーザーにとって非常に読みやすい選択肢です。
アクセシブルなフォームデザインとは?
アクセシブルなフォームデザインとは、あらゆるユーザーが容易に利用できるように配慮されたフォームの設計を指します。
特に、障害を持つ方々にとって、その重要性は非常に高いです。
アクセシブルなフォームデザインは、すべてのユーザーが簡単にアクセスし、利用できるように設計されたフォームを意味します。
このデザインは、視覚障害や運動障害、聴覚障害を持つ人々に特に配慮したものです。
具体的には、視覚的な情報を音声で伝えるためのスクリーンリーダーとの互換性を考慮し、ラベルを明確にすることや、色覚特性に配慮したカラーコントラストの設定が必要です。
また、キーボードのみでの操作が可能なナビゲーション設計も重要な要素です。
さらに、入力フィールドのエラーメッセージを分かりやすく提示し、記入漏れや誤入力に対して適切なフィードバックを提供することが、アクセシビリティの向上に寄与します。
このように、アクセシブルなフォームデザインは、障害の有無にかかわらず、誰もが簡単に利用できることを目指しています。
アクセシビリティの基本概念
アクセシビリティとは、全ての人が情報やサービスにアクセスできることを目指す非常に重要な考え方です。
特に、障害を持つ人々に配慮したデザインが求められるのです。
アクセシビリティは、ウェブサイトやアプリケーションがすべてのユーザーにとって利用可能であることを保障するための設計哲学です。
視覚や聴覚に障害がある人々、さらには高齢者や一時的な障害を抱える方々にとって、特に重要な要素です。
アクセシビリティを考慮したデザインにより、誰もが情報に簡単にアクセスでき、平等にサービスを利用できるようになります。
そのためには、色に依存しない情報伝達や、スクリーンリーダーに対応したテキストの配置、キーボード操作によるナビゲーションの確保などが不可欠です。
こうした配慮がなされることで、多様なユーザーが快適に利用できる環境が整います。
また、アクセシビリティを重視したウェブサイトは、検索エンジンにとっても好まれるため、SEOにもプラスの影響を与えることがあります。
全ての人に開かれたデジタルワールドを目指すためには、アクセシビリティへの理解と実践が欠かせません。
フォームデザインにおけるアクセシビリティの重要性
アクセシビリティは、すべてのユーザーが情報にアクセスできる状態を確保することを目的としています。
特にフォームデザインにおいては、視覚や聴覚に障害のある人々を含む、さまざまな背景を持つユーザーが利用できるように配慮することが非常に重要です。
フォームは、ユーザーが情報を入力したり、サービスを利用したりする際の重要なインターフェースです。
アクセシビリティのあるフォームデザインは、すべての人々が利用できることを目的としています。
特に、視力に障害がある方や、読み書きに困難を抱える方、そして高齢者など、特定のニーズを持つユーザーに対して配慮することが不可欠です。
こうした人々がフォームを利用できるかどうかは、情報アクセスの平等に直接つながります。
具体的には、ラベルと入力フィールドの適切な関連付け、十分なコントラスト、キーボード操作の対応などが求められます。
また、スクリーンリーダーを使用するユーザーのために、適切なHTMLマークアップを用いることも必須です。
これにより、音声合成ソフトウェアが正しく情報を解釈できるようになります。
さらに、アクセシブルなフォームデザインは、ユーザーエクスペリエンスの向上に寄与するだけでなく、法的な面でも必要とされています。
多くの国では、障害者に対するサービス提供に関する法律が整備されており、違反すると法的責任を問われる可能性があります。
そのため、ビジネスやプロジェクトにおいて、アクセシビリティを考慮することは倫理的・法的な観点からも重要です。
このように、フォームデザインにおけるアクセシビリティは、社会全体における情報の平等を実現するために欠かせない要素です。
すべてのユーザーが快適に利用できるフォームを設計することで、より多くの人々に価値のある情報を提供できるようになります。
ユーザーインターフェースの工夫と障害への配慮
アクセシブルなフォームデザインは、すべてのユーザーが使いやすいインターフェースを提供するために重要です。
視覚、聴覚、運動能力などに配慮したデザインが求められます。
ユーザーインターフェースの工夫には、色のコントラスト、フォントサイズ、サイズやスペースの調整が含まれます。
視覚に障害のある人向けには、高コントラストの配色や大きな文字を使用することが効果的です。
また、視覚的な情報だけでなく、音声やテキストによるフィードバックも重要です。
これにより、情報を理解しやすくなります。
障害への配慮として、キーボードナビゲーションの導入が挙げられます。
マウスを使えないユーザーのために、全ての機能をキーボードで操作できるようにすることが必要不可欠です。
また、フォームの説明やエラーメッセージは明確にし、音声読み上げソフトウェアが正しく読み上げられるようにする配慮も重要です。
さらには、ユーザーがエラーをしやすい部分には、サポート情報を近くに表示することで、迷わずに正しく入力できるようにします。
例えば、必須項目には明確なマークを付けたり、入力例を示すことが効果的です。
このような工夫を施すことで、すべてのユーザーにとって使いやすいフォームデザインが実現できます。
より使いやすいフォームを作るためのベストプラクティス
より使いやすいフォームを作成するためには、シンプルなレイアウト、明確なラベル、適切なフィードバックが重要です。
特に視覚障害者や高齢者への配慮が必要です。
フォームデザインにおいて、まず最初に考慮すべきはシンプルさです。
必要最低限のフィールドを表示し、ユーザーが混乱しないように工夫しましょう。
各フィールドには、明確で簡単なラベルを付け、情報が必要な理由を簡潔に説明することが望ましいです。
次に、フィールドの配置も非常に重要です。
論理的な順序で配置することで、ユーザーが自然と入力を進めやすくなります。
特に、視覚的なヒントやプレースホルダーを活用して、どの情報を求めているのかを明示することが助けとなります。
また、エラーメッセージやフィードバックは、実用的で分かりやすいものであるべきです。
ユーザーが入力エラーをした場合には、その理由を具体的に指摘し、修正方法を示すことで、次回の入力がスムーズに行えるようになります。
色のコントラストやフォントのサイズなど、アクセシビリティも考慮することが大変重要です。
視覚に障害のある方などが利用する際に、読みやすいデザインにすることが求められます。
これらのポイントを踏まえ、より多くの人に優しいフォームの実現を目指しましょう。
アクセシビリティテストの方法とツール
アクセシビリティテストは、ユーザーがウェブサイトやアプリをどれだけ快適に利用できるかを確かめるための重要なプロセスです。
テストには、さまざまな手法やツールが存在します。
アクセシビリティテストは、ウェブサイトやアプリが障害を持つユーザーにとって使いやすいかどうかを確認するために欠かせないプロセスです。
主な方法には、手動テストと自動テストがあります。
手動テストでは、実際のユーザーやアクセシビリティ専門家がウェブサイトを使用し、問題点を見つけ出します。
自動テストは、特定のツールを使用してコードや要素を確認する方法であり、これにより効率的に問題を洗い出すことが可能です。
自動テストツールには、「WAVE」や「Axe」「Lighthouse」などがあり、それぞれ特定のアクセシビリティの問題をチェックします。
手動テストを行う際には、特にキーボード操作とスクリーンリーダーによる体験を重視することが非常に重要です。
これによって、そのウェブサイトが視覚障害を持つユーザーにどのように受け入れられるかを理解することができます。
また、フィードバックを集めるためにユーザビリティテストを実施することも効果的です。
最終的に、アクセシビリティテストは継続的なプロセスであり、定期的に行うことで、多くのユーザーが利用しやすいサービスを提供することができます。
デザインと開発の初期段階から、アクセシビリティを考慮することが成功の鍵となります。
